Pokhara Nepal

AND OFF WE GO!! TO POKHARA! The bus from Kathmandu to Nepal takes about 7 hours. The amount of waking up, dozing off and stops are included. I was initially worried that the bus would not make any stops as I don't know if there are any R&R area like in many of the countries I have been to AND- I was wrong. Although it is not the traditional designated area for R&R but rest assured there is. There are 2 stops in general. One for late breakfast and the other is for a quick stop to the loo. You will meet other travelers also made their 'pit-stop' here too. Some will be queuing for the toilets, while to my surprise some vomit out their meals from the rough ride. (yes the roads are long and winding) My best advise is to sleep most of the time you are on the road. We reached Pokhara later in the evening.
